COMMENT: IPS HF Communications Warning 6 was issued on 1 March
and is current for interval 1-2 March. Enhanced HF conditions
observed during the last 24 hours across most regions. Enhanced
conditions during local night for Equatorial regions while Northern
AUS, Southern AUS/NZ regions experienced enhanced MUFs during
local day, with otherwise mostly normal conditions. Disturbed
HF conditions for Antarctic regions. Chance of depressed MUF's
ranging from 10-20% during local day for Northen AUS and Southern
AUS/NZ regions over the next 24-48 hours along with overnight
enhancements. Continued disturbed conditions for Antarctic regions.
Expected return to normal conditions between 03Mar-04Mar.
